In the dusty heat of the 1870s American West, the sleepy frontier town of Rock Ridge finds its future tangled up with a booming railroad project. The promise of progress and profit roils the quiet streets, turning ordinary townsfolk into uneasy participants in a grand, chaotic undertaking. The film rides this unsettled landscape with a razor‑sharp satire, letting absurdity and irreverence color every storefront, saloon, and clanking steel rail, while the frontier’s rugged charm remains ever‑present.
Into this maelstrom steps Bart, a Black railroad worker thrust into the unlikely role of sheriff by a well‑meaning but clueless governor. His appointment is meant as a joke, but the newcomer brings a cool intellect and a surprising knack for defusing tension with wit as much as with a badge. At his side is Jim, the hard‑drinking gunslinger known as the “Waco Kid,” whose laid‑back swagger and quick draw provide a perfect foil to Bart’s measured approach. Their uneasy partnership blossoms amidst a cast of eccentric locals, each adding a distinct flavor to the town’s already volatile mix.
Beyond the immediate humor, the story hints at deeper undercurrents: a cunning, corrupt politician scheming behind the scenes, and a ragtag gang whose presence promises to tip the delicate balance. Yet the true heart of the film lies in its celebration of community—white townspeople, Chinese laborers, Irish immigrants, and others crossing cultural lines in the name of survival and laughter.
